The Value of a Small Initial Profit Goal

When starting a new venture, it can be helpful to set a concrete, achievable short-term goal to provide focus and a clear measure of progress. A particularly effective initial goal for a self-funded startup is to aim for a modest but consistent level of profit.

A Good Starting Point: $500/month

Striving to build a startup that generates $500 per month in profit is an excellent short-term goal. While this may sound like a small amount, the amount of work required to achieve it is substantial.

The Benefits of a Small Profit Goal

Once you have successfully built a startup that generates a consistent $500 per month, you will have gained an incredible amount of knowledge and experience, which will be invaluable for the future growth of your business.
